The blog post introduces a “Threat Intelligence Enrichment Agent” powered by Claude, designed to automate the labor-intensive tasks of security analysts. This agent streamlines the process of querying multiple threat intelligence sources, such as VirusTotal and AbuseIPDB, to gather data on Indicators of Compromise (IOCs) and deliver structured, analyst-ready reports. Key functionalities include intelligently selecting intelligence sources, correlating findings from multiple databases, and mapping to the MITRE ATT&CK framework.
The post outlines essential steps to set up the environment, define tools for different types of threat intelligence gathering, and illustrates how to create simulated backends for these functions. Included are prerequisites such as Python 3.10+ and an Anthropic API key. Ultimately, this automation facilitates faster and more accurate threat intelligence workflows in both enterprise SOCs and security software development.
